    Abstract: A method for determining a concentration of a target gas in blood of a human or animal animate being. The method includes the steps of: generating electromagnetic excitation radiation having a carrier frequency, wherein the carrier frequency is selected such that the target gas and an absorbing gas absorb the excitation radiation, modulating an amplitude or the carrier frequency of the excitation radiation with a modulation frequency, illuminating an absorption path superficial to a skin of the animate being with the excitation radiation, generating a sound wave by an absorption of the excitation radiation in the absorption gas, and detecting at least one of an amplitude and a phase of the sound wave as a measure of a concentration of the target gas on the absorption path. Also provided is a photoacoustic sensor for determining a concentration of a target gas in blood of a human or animal animate being.

    Abstract: The invention relates to a gear device for a motor vehicle, as is used, for example, for adjusting a camshaft in a combustion engine in order to influence the phase angle between crankshaft and camshaft. Such gear devices have to be constructed compactly and also have to have high resistance to wear, in particular upon reaching end stops during adjustment of the phase angle. For this purpose, the gear device has hydraulic end stop damping by the drive unit and the output unit having communicating cavities.

    Abstract: The disclosure relates to a hydraulic camshaft phaser for relative rotation between a camshaft and a crankshaft. The camshaft phaser comprising two oppositely acting working chambers to which hydraulic medium pressure can be applied in a controlling manner by means of a hydraulic valve, thereby causing a relative rotation between the camshaft and the crankshaft. A volume accumulator formed by the camshaft phaser collects the hydraulic medium exiting from the working chambers. The volume accumulator is divided into two partial volume accumulators which flank the working chambers in an axial direction and which are connected to one another by a hydraulic medium line which extends axially through the camshaft phaser and is independent of the working chambers.

    Abstract: Known infrared radiators have a moulded body, which has a radiation surface that emits short-wave or medium-wave infrared radiation with a first peak emission wavelength. In order to provide, proceeding therefrom, an infrared radiator with an emissions spectrum which is well matched to absorption characteristics with a maximum around 2750 nm, and which furthermore can be operated with a high electrical power density, and with which the warming-up time in industrial applications, such as, for example, drying of inks, joining of plastics or bending of glass, can be shortened, according to the invention a radiation converter material is applied to at least a part of the radiation surface and, as a consequence of heating by the infrared radiation of the first peak emission wavelength, emits infrared radiation with a second peak emission wavelength which is of a longer wavelength than the first peak emission wavelength.

    Abstract: The disclosure relates to an electromechanical camshaft adjuster comprising an electric motor and an adjusting gear, which has a housing with two housing parts that are sealed off with respect to each other by means of a static seal and with respect to the electric motor and a cylinder head by means of two dynamic seals. A first housing part of the adjusting gear has a pot shape that tapers in a stepped manner towards a housing bottom of the housing part, said pot shape having three different inner diameter regions. In the region closest to the bottom with the smallest inner diameter, a stop plate that acts in the circumferential direction is held. In the region with the middle inner diameter, an output ring gear is mounted with play, and in the region with the largest inner diameter, an input ring gear is secured.

    Abstract: The invention relates to a control arrangement for vehicles having a hydrostatic auxiliary drive for one or more axles, in particular for motor graders, having a drive engine, driven rear wheels coupled to the drive engine, further wheels which can be activated by associated hydraulic motors and can be operated by a hydraulic pump coupled to the drive engine and which has an adjustable feed volume, wherein each wheel is connected to a hydraulic motor without a clutch. The hydraulic pump and the hydraulic motors can be activated electrically and adjusted in a continuously variable fashion and the hydraulic pump is connected directly, without valves, to the hydraulic motors in parallel by hydraulic lines. The control device controls the respective displacement volume of the hydraulic motors only as a function of the rotational speed signals of the sensors.

    Abstract: A component includes a sub-region, where the component is produced at least in the sub-region by an additive manufacturing process. The sub-region is produced from an aluminum alloy which has 12% by weight to 40% by weight silicon, 0.3% by weight to 4% by weight copper, 0.2% by weight to 0.7% by weight magnesium, at most 1% by weight iron, at most 0.5% by weight zirconium, and a remainder which includes aluminum and further accompanying elements and/or production-related impurities that each have a mass fraction of at most 0.3 percent individually and that in total have a mass fraction of at most 1.5 percent.

    Abstract: A camshaft phaser for variably adjusting the control times of gas exchange valves of an internal combustion engine, including: a stator and a rotor which can be rotated relative to the stator, wherein a plurality of hydraulic chambers are formed between the stator and the that are separated by radially inwardly projecting webs of the stator. Radially outwardly projecting vanes are formed on the rotor that divide each of the hydraulic chambers into first and second groups of working chambers with an opposing effective direction. A pressure medium pump is adapted to apply a pressure medium to the working chambers. A central valve controls the oil pressure in the working chambers. The pressure medium pump is directly connected to the working chambers in each ease via a pressure medium channel; the central valve is connected to the working chambers via discharge channels; and the central valve exclusively controls the pressure medium discharge from the working chambers.
